Zeltrestaurant Bohrerhof, Regional restaurant in Hartheim am Rhein, Germany.
The Zeltrestaurant Bohrerhof is a dining establishment in Hartheim am Rhein with a tent-style roof and spacious eating areas that overlook the garden. The kitchen prepares dishes using products sourced from the Markgräflerland region.
The establishment has built a presence as a dining venue in the region over time while preserving traditional cooking techniques. Working with ingredients from local farmers and producers continues to define the restaurant's work today.
The restaurant serves as a meeting place for regional specialties, where visitors can taste local sausages and handcrafted products from nearby producers. The selection reflects the establishment's connection to makers in the Markgräflerland area.
The location sits on Bachstraße and has room for many guests, both for individuals and larger groups or events. The open layout and garden setting make it simple to orient yourself and find a table.
During the cooler months from September through December, the kitchen offers special menus featuring game and seasonal vegetables from the Black Forest. This seasonal offering shows the close connection to nature and the rhythm of the seasons in the region.
